Sustainability of Life Cycle Management for Nuclear
Cementation-Based Technologies, edited by Dr. Rahman and Dr.
Ojovan, presents the latest knowledge and research on the
management of cementitious systems within nuclear power plants. The
book covers aging, development and updates on regulatory frameworks
on a global scale, the development of cementitious systems for the
immobilization of problematic wastes, and the decommissioning and
decontamination of complex cementitious systems. The book's editors
and their team of experts combine their practical knowledge to
provide the reader with a thorough understanding on the
sustainability of lifecycle management of cementitious systems
within the nuclear industry. Sections provide a comparative tool
that presents national regulations concerning cementitious systems
within nuclear power plants, check international and national
evaluation results of the sustainability of different systems, help
in the development of performance test procedures, and provide a
guide on aging nuclear power plants and the long-term behavior of
these systems in active and passive safety environments.

Nuclear Waste Management Facilities: Advances, Environmental
Impacts, and Future Prospects examines best practices and recent
trends in improving nuclear safety and reducing the negative
environmental impacts of nuclear waste. With strong emphasis on
regulatory requirements, this reference is essential for designing
new integrated waste management practices, using lessons learned
from historical and current practices. Divided into three key
sections, Part One introduces the reader to the safety and
environmental impacts of the nuclear industry. Part Two reviews
recent technological and methodological approaches to enhancing
safety, as well as reducing the carbon footprint of both individual
processes and integrated facilities. Topics covered include waste
processing, transmutation and decommissioning. Part Three consider
potential management schemes for special waste from innovative
sources, and wastes that contain emerging contaminants, including
waste recycling opportunities. Nuclear Waste Management Facilities:
Advances, Environmental Impacts, and Future Prospects is a crucial
tool needed to implement the safest and most environmentally
considerate best practices within nuclear waste management
facilities.

This new volume addresses the growing use of organic farming in
recent past decades fueled by the concern with the many deleterious
effects of conventional agricultural practices, which employ
chemical fertilizers, pesticides, and herbicides for large scale
production of food. It focuses on sustainable development in
farming, primarily detailing the application of different natural
resources as manure for organic farming. The authors discuss
efficient and cost-effective uses of natural and available
resources to produce healthy food while at the same time helping to
conserve the environment. Section I of Organic Farming for
Sustainable Development discusses in detail the application of
microorganisms such as Trichoderma sp., Azospirillum sp.,
endophytic microorganisms, arbuscular mycorrhiza, Chaetomium sp.,
and bioactive secondary metabolites in organic farming practices.
Section II explores the potential applications of organic
amendments and sustainable practices for plant growth and soil
health using garlic products, organic substrates, biochar, organic
mulching, and tillage and weed management. In addition, Section III
summarizes the impacts and prospects of organic crop production
technology on health, food safety, and quality. The authors bring
together important information that will be helpful in designing
organic farming methods for soil sustainability and crop
productivity as well as for nutritious food produced efficiently
and cost productively. The book provides valuable insight to
efficiently and cost-effectively use natural and available
resources to increase the nutrient content of our food as well as
to manage the organic wastes coming from other sectors, such as
from cattle farms without polluting the surroundings.
Engineering Solid Mechanics bridges the gap between elementary
approaches to strength of materials and more advanced, specialized
versions on the subject. The book provides a basic understanding of
the fundamentals of elasticity and plasticity, applies these
fundamentals to solve analytically a spectrum of engineering
problems, and introduces advanced topics of mechanics of materials
- including fracture mechanics, creep, superplasticity, fiber
reinforced composites, powder compacts, and porous solids. Text
includes: stress and strain, equilibrium, and compatibility elastic
stress-strain relations the elastic problem and the stress function
approach to solving plane elastic problems applications of the
stress function solution in Cartesian and polar coordinates
Problems of elastic rods, plates, and shells through formulating a
strain compatibility function as well as applying energy methods
Elastic and elastic-plastic fracture mechanics Plastic and creep
deformation Inelastic deformation and its applications This book
presents the material in an instructive manner, suitable for
individual self-study. It emphasizes analytical treatment of the
subject, which is essential for handling modern numerical methods
as well as assessing and creating software packages. The authors
provide generous explanations, systematic derivations, and detailed
discussions, supplemented by a vast variety of problems and solved
examples. Primarily written for professionals and students in
mechanical engineering, Engineering Solid Mechanics also serves
persons in other fields of engineering, such as aerospace, civil,
and material engineering.

Get all the facts and build your expertise on the fast-growing
practice of home hemodialysis The use of home hemodialysis is
becoming more popular every year. Home dialysis modalities not only
provide more flexibility for patients, they are associated with
numerous benefits, including improved cardiovascular parameters and
better quality of life. Most dialysis resources tend to focus on
in-center hemodialysis with little to no discussion of home
hemodialysis. The Handbook of Home Hemodialysis aims to change that
with focused, detailed coverage on the topic. This timely,
one-of-a-kind resource offers everything you need to build your
expertise on the subject. It's also small enough to fit in your
pocket and designed to provide accurate, easy-to-find answers on
the fly. Clear drawings and illustrations clarify and highlight key
information. The Handbook of Home Hemodialysis provides essential
information on: The of history home hemodialysis Vascular access
Patient recruitment and training Prescribing home hemodialysis
Water handling Laboratory parameters/monitoring Emerging benefits
Common complications Special populations Remote monitoring Building
a home dialysis program, and more

This volume presents some advances in the analysis and design of
deep foundations. It contains 21 technical papers covering various
aspects of analysis and design of deep foundations based on
full-scale field testing, numerical modeling and analytical
solutions. They present results and findings from research as well
as practical-oriented studies on deep foundations that are of
interest to civil/geotechnical engineering community. The topics
cover a wide spectrum of applications that include evaluation of
the axial and lateral capacity of piles, pile group effects,
evaluation of the increase in pile capacity with time (or pile
setup), influence of excavation on pile capacity, study the
behavior of pile raft caisson foundations, evaluation of the
bearing capacity and settlement of piles from cone penetration
tests, etc. The volume is based on the best contributions to the
2nd GeoMEast International Congress and Exhibition on Sustainable
Civil Infrastructures, Egypt 2018 - The official international
congress of the Soil-Structure Interaction Group in Egypt (SSIGE).

A compact and useable introduction to the understanding of
contemporary Sudan, and a convenient reference work. The Sudan
Handbook, based on the Rift Valley Institute's successful Sudan
Field Course, is an authoritative and accessible introduction to
Sudan, vividly written and edited by leading Sudanese and
international specialists. The handbook offers a concise
introduction to all aspects of the country, rooted in a broad
historical account of the development of the Sudanese state. It
consists of eighteen self-contained, cross-referenced chapters,
covering essential topics in the geography, history, sociology,
culture and politics of the country, written by outstanding
Sudanese scholars and recognized international experts. It includes
numerous purpose-drawn maps and diagrams,glossaries of key terms,
capsule biographies of key figures, a chronology and a
bibliography. John Ryle, Rift Valley Institute and Division of
Social Sciences, Bard College, USA; Justin Willis, Department of
History, Durham University, UK and former Director of the British
Institute in Eastern Africa; Suliman Baldo, International Center
for Transitional Justice, New York, International Crisis Group; Jok
Madut Jok, Department of History, LoyolaMarymount University, USA.
Published in association with the Rift Valley Institute
